What You Need to Know Right Now About Feeding Your Baby Peanuts
New guidelines released this week recommend parents feed babies peanut-based foods as early as six months of age. Evidence suggests that doing so could help prevent peanut allergies. This is a change from previous advice that suggested introducing peanut-based products before toddler-age could actually lead to a peanut allergy.
